Chocolate-Cherry Punsch-Roll Recipe

Ingredients with Measurements:
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up butter, softened
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 2 e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up cherry preserves
- 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ts
- 1/2 cup Punsch liqueur

Special Equipment Needed:
- 9x13-inch baking pan
- Electric mixer
- Rolling pin

Step-by-Step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ease and flour a 9x13-inch baking pan.
2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
3.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
4. Beat in the eggs, one at a time, until fully incorporated.
5. Beat in the vanilla extract.
6. Gradually add the flour mixture to the butter mixture, stirring until just combined.
7. Spread the dough into the prepared pan.
8. Spread the cherry preserves over the dough.
9. Sprinkle the chocolate chips and walnuts over the preserves.
10. Drizzle the Punsch liqueur over the top.
11. Roll the dough into a log shape.
12.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own.
13. Let cool before slicing.
